次に、ボタンの背景色とボタンを押したときに表示されるテキストを変更しましょう。
のは、npm run run-android
を使用してアプリを再インストールしてみましょう。
コードを変更してアプリケーションを再インストールした後でも、すべてが同じように見えます。
clj
ファイルに変更を加えましたが、まだ行っていないことの一つは、実際にバンドラによってロードされたファイルであるindex.android.js
を更新するためにコードを再構築することです。
これはfigwheelが絵に入ってくるところです。 それがなければ、コードを変更するたびにアプリケーションを手動で再構築してインストールする必要があります。 project.clj
をチェックすると、これがprod
プロファイルで起こることに気付くでしょう。 Figwheelはなく、プロジェクトをビルドするたびにindex.android.js
とindex.ios.js
が更新されます。
lein with-profile prod cljsbuild auto
しかし、これは開発中の非常に遅いフィードバックサイクルです。 したがって、figwheelを使用する別のdev
プロファイルがあります。 Figwheelの使用を開始するには、次のコマンドを実行します(エミュレータが事前に実行されていることを確認してください)
1. re-natal use-android-device avd
2. re-natal use-figwheel
3. lein figwheel android
4. npm run run-android
今、あなたはあなたのコードに変更を加え、リアルタイムで結果を見ることができます!
それはそれです! 読んでくれてありがとう、そして私はあなたが記事を楽しんだことを願っています。 次の部分では、最初からアプリケーションを構築してみましょう!
あなたはMediumとGithubで私に従うこともできます。 🙂